Description

The Council operates a HAS which provides an end-to-end agency service for clients who have been assessed by Occupational Therapists as requiring adaptations to their homes. These include owner-occupiers and tenants of Registered Providers or private landlords within the Borough. Funding is provided through the Council’s Disabled Facilities Grant (DFG) budget, however as the grant is means-tested some clients are required to make a contribution. The agency service is delivered by the Council’s Housing Adaptation Service (HAS) and includes the provision of drawings and specifications and the selection and management of contractors through to completion of works.

National Trust NI - Divis - A View to the Future Works Project

Divis - A View to the Future Project has been made possible with The National Lottery Heritage Fund. Thanks to National Lottery players, we are improving access, enhancing engagement and ensuring the long-term protection of this unique landscape. This Request for Proposal (RFP) sets out the Trust's situation and objectives in respect of the "Divis - A View to the Future Project". The proposed works within this project lie across Divis and the Black Mountain, Northern Ireland, with four main areas of focus at the visitor hub and entrance from Divis Road, the Summit, the boardwalk south of Divis masts, and the existing farm track connecting the eastern side of the site to the Glencairn Road. Out with these areas, elements of signage and interpretation are required along the walking trails. The RFI seeks initial information from a range of suppliers as to possible solutions, capacity, capability and relevant experience. This two-stage procurement process is for the appointment of a Main Contractor / Principal Contractor to deliver the construction works associated with capital works outlined in the tender pack. Stage One (RFP1) seeks initial information from a range of suppliers as to capacity, capability and relevant experience. The successful bidders from the RFP1 process will be invited to the second stage, RFP2, where a Proposal Costing will be requested.
